Friction Labs Climbing Chalk

Unicorns, Gorillas, and Bam Bams, Oh, My!

First things first.  Friction Labs chalk feels awesome.  To me, it feels better than Bison.  It is silky smooth and I can see and feel it get inside of every single fold and print on my fingers and palms.  It coats my hands thoroughly and stays on my hands through at least two burns…usually longer.  To my hands, I do feel a degree of improved friction with the Friction Labs chalk compared to my Bison.  I am impressed.

How I Tested Friction Labs Climbing Chalk At The Gym

At my gym, I set up different chalk bags with the 3 different Friction Labs chalks and the Bison as my baseline.  I climbed laps and used a different chalk each burn.  It was easy for me to feel the difference between the Friction Labs and the Bison chalks.  What was most surprising was that my fingers can not differentiate among the three blends of Friction Labs chalks after I worked the chalk into my hands and climbed.  I tried and tired to feel a difference, but I could not.  The Unicorn Dust definitely feels different when I initially touch the chalk.  I don’t know if that is a positive or negative, it was just my experience.  I can tell that Friction Labs feels better or stickier or frictionyer (more frictiony?) than Bison by a degree.  I can tell that Friction Labs feels significantly better than the Evolv that I have in my house for working out on the pull up bar.

How I Tested Friction Labs Chalk At Home

Pull ups, baby.  I use my climbing chalk in my garage pull up bar.  I can do multiple sets of pull ups with just one dose of Friction Labs chalk.  Even with Bison, I would chalk up each time.  Friction Labs chalk kept my hands dry and made it easy to stay on the bar.  Sweaty hands were not the failure point on my pull up sets.  This stuff is good for workouts at home on your pull up bars, barbells, dumbbells, kettlebells.  Keep some at home.
